Job Description :
Client is seeking a highly skilled Full Stack Java Developer with strong Python expertise and proven experience delivering applications in Banking or Capital Markets environments. The ideal candidate will have a deep understanding of enterprise-scale financial systems strong back-end and front-end development skills and the ability to design build and optimize high-performance solutions for critical business functions.
Responsibilities
- Design develop and maintain robust Java-based back-end services and React front-end applications .
- Collaborate with business analysts product owners and architects to translate requirements into technical solutions.
- Implement and consume RESTful APIs and microservices ensuring high availability and scalability.
- Build user interfaces that are responsive intuitive and secure for front-office and middle-office banking applications.
- Optimize application performance and ensure adherence to security and regulatory standards in financial services.
- Participate in code reviews enforce development best practices and contribute to continuous improvement efforts.
- Support deployment pipelines and integrate solutions within CI / CD environments .
- Troubleshoot debug and resolve issues across the full technology stack.
Qualifications
Bachelors degree in Computer Science Engineering or related field (or equivalent work experience).12 years of Java development experience with strong proficiency in Java 8 / Spring / Spring Boot .Strong experience with Python Redux JavaScript / TypeScript HTML5 CSS3 .Solid experience building REST APIs and integrating with enterprise data platforms.Hands-on experience with SQL (Oracle PostgreSQL or SQL Server) and ORM frameworks (Hibernate / JPA).Knowledge of banking systems capital markets or financial product workflows .Familiarity with CI / CD tools (Jenkins GitHub Actions Azure DevOps) and cloud platforms (AWS Azure or GCP).Strong communication and problem-solving skills; ability to work effectively in fast-paced regulated environments.Nice to Have
Experience with messaging systems (Kafka MQ) or event-driven architectures.Knowledge of microservices orchestration (Docker Kubernetes).Exposure to risk trading or settlement systems in capital markets.Familiarity with security best practices (OAuth2 SAML encryption standards).Key Skills
REST,Eclipse,JSP,Junit,Spring,Struts,Jpa,Hibernate,Maven,J2EE,Jdbc,Java
Employment Type : Full Time
Experience : years
Vacancy : 1